Globale Empowerment
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 205,000 | 5,000 | 200,000 | 480.0 | 0% |
| 2020 | 10,145 | 2,690 | 7,455 | 925.4 | — |
| 2021 | 150,145 | 1,822 | 148,323 | 2343.2 | — |
In its most recent public year (2021), this organization brought in $148,323 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 2343.2 months of spending, up from 480 in 2019.
